Loco Hills, New Mexico, is a small unincorporated community with a population of approximately 125 people. It is located in the southeastern part of the state, about 22 miles west of the city of Hobbs. The zip code for Loco Hills is 88255. The area is known for its oil and gas production, and the majority of residents work in this industry. It is a rural and isolated community, with limited amenities and services.
